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ids vs Sunflower Seed Flour:
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ids have 34.4 times more Vitamin C than Sunflower Seed Flour.
While 500 kcal of Partially Defatted Sunflower Seed Flour contain 35.7 times more Vitamin B1, 10.7 times more Vitamin B3, 10.7 times more Vitamin B5, 14.1 times more Vitamin B6 and 16.6 times more Vitamin B9 than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ids.
Both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ids and Sunflower Seed Flour prov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2 per 500 calories.
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B3,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B9
500 calories of Sunflower Seed Flour have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
Both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ids as well as Partially Defatted Sunflower Seed Flour have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in B12 in 500 calories.
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ids vs Sunflower Seed Flour:
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ids have 5.1 times more Potassium and 47.9 times more Water than Sunflower Seed Flour.
While 500 kcal of Partially Defatted Sunflower Seed Flour contain 1.6 times more Calcium, 1.8 times more Copper, 4.5 times more Iron, 12.9 times more Magnesium, 2.5 times more Manganese, 22 times more Phosphorus, 32.6 times more Selenium and 10.1 times more Zinc than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ids.
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ids lack sufficient amounts of Magnesium, Phosphorus, Selenium and Zinc
500 calories of Sunflower Seed Flour lack sufficient amounts of Potassium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ids have 2.3 times more Carbohydrate and 2.1 times more Fiber than Sunflower Seed Flour.
While 500 kcal of Partially Defatted Sunflower Seed Flour contain 16.6 times more Protein than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ids.
Both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ids and Sunflower Seed Flour offer comparable quantities of Energy per 500 calories.
500 calories of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ids provide inadequate amounts of Protein
Both Gooseberries, canned, light syrup pack, solids and liquids as well as Partially Defatted Sunflower Seed Flour prov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 and Omega 6 in 500 calories.
